The server said there are over 500 items on the menu. I've eaten there twice and haven't been completely impressed. The Italian meal I had was okay, but nothing special. Today, I had country fried steak. The best thing I can say about it was that it was plentiful. No, I take that back. The best thing about the meal was the seafood bisque. The rest of the meal was incredibly lacking in flavor. No wonder the parking lot is always empty whenever I drive by there. A little salt did wonders to improve the mashed potatoes and sauteed veggies, but nothing could help the gravy. It tasted like raw flour, so I scraped it off as best I could. The one really big positive was the service. The server was attentive enough to make sure that I was as happy as I could be with the meal, but not so attentive that she got on my nerves. My recommendation to this restaurant is to pare down the menu by about half, and teach the cooks how to do those items really well.
Pros: plentiful portions, great seafood bisque, convenient location
Cons: bland food, overwhelming menu
